The Most Common Furniture Mistake in UAE Interiors

The most common furniture problem in UAE homes is not bad quality — it is wrong scale. A sofa that is beautiful in a showroom but too large for the living room it goes into, so it blocks the pathway and makes the room feel smaller than it is. A dining table that seats eight but is too long for the space, so chairs cannot be comfortably pulled out on both sides. A bed that fills a bedroom correctly in width but sits too high for the ceiling, making the headboard feature look cramped rather than luxurious. A coffee table that is the right material but 10 centimetres too tall for the sofa height, making every cup placed on it feel awkward.

None of these are showroom problems — they are planning problems that only become visible when the piece arrives in the room. NESMAT Interior approaches furniture selection the way a skilled interior designer approaches it: room dimensions first, furniture scale second, style direction third, material selection fourth. The sequence matters because a furniture piece that fits incorrectly cannot be compensated for by how good it looks. And in the UAE, where delivery timelines for premium furniture can be 8–16 weeks and return logistics are complex, getting the scale right before ordering is not a preference — it is a financial necessity.

Furniture Scale Guide

The Correct Furniture Dimensions for UAE Villa & Apartment Rooms

UAE homes have generous proportions — and generous proportions require appropriately scaled furniture. These are the key dimension references NESMAT uses when specifying furniture for UAE residential projects. Showroom pieces are often designed for smaller European rooms; these adjustments correct for UAE room scales.

Room / PieceCommon MistakeCorrect UAE ScaleWhy It Matters
Villa Living Room Sofa3-seater at 220–240 cm chosen because it “fills the wall” in a showroom3-seater at 260–300 cm, or L-shape configuration from 320 cm, in rooms of 6 metres or widerA standard 220 cm sofa in a villa lounge with a 6+ metre wall looks visually adrift — the room swallows the furniture rather than the furniture defining the room
Coffee TableChosen by appearance in isolation — material and style selected without checking height relative to sofa seat heightCoffee table height should be within 5 cm of the sofa seat height — typically 40–45 cm for most UAE sofasA coffee table that is too high requires reaching up to place items; too low looks like a display piece rather than a functional surface. The proportion between seat and table height defines daily comfort
Dining TableStandard 240 cm dining table ordered for a room that needs 280–300 cm to allow comfortable chair movement on all sidesAllow 90 cm minimum between the pulled-out chair and the nearest wall or furniture — add this to the table length and width before selecting table dimensionsDining tables that are too large for the room mean chairs cannot be comfortably pulled out, guests on the end seats are pressed against walls and the room feels smaller than it is for the entire lifespan of the furniture
Master Bedroom BedKing-size bed (180 cm wide) placed in a room without checking clearance on both sides and at the foot70 cm minimum clearance on both sides of the bed, 90 cm at the foot — confirm these dimensions in the actual room before specifying bed widthA master bedroom where you must squeeze past the bed to reach the wardrobe does not feel luxurious regardless of the bed’s quality. Circulation clearances define the daily experience of the room
Dining ChairsChairs selected for visual compatibility with the table without checking seat height against table heightSeat height of 45–48 cm for standard dining tables at 75–76 cm height — confirm seat-to-table clearance allows comfortable legroom (minimum 25–30 cm)Uncomfortable dining chairs are noticed at every meal. The furniture can be visually perfect and functionally wrong if this dimension is not confirmed before ordering
Office DeskExecutive desk selected by visual presence without checking the chair clearance behind it for a visitor chair across the deskAllow 120 cm behind the desk chair position for comfortable seating and standing; 90 cm between the desk and any side storage unit or wallAn executive office where the chair cannot be comfortably pushed back, or where visitor chairs are cramped against the bookcase, undermines the professional impression the room is supposed to project

UAE Context

Why Furniture Selection in the UAE Needs Specific Thinking

Furnishing a UAE home or business involves variables that standard European or Asian furniture showrooms are not designed to address. Understanding them upfront saves significant cost and frustration.

UAE Room Proportions Are Generous

UAE villas and premium apartments have ceiling heights of 3 metres or above and living areas that are significantly larger than European equivalents. Standard furniture proportions — designed for 2.4m ceilings and 4m-wide living rooms — look undersized in these spaces. A sofa that is the right scale for a European apartment becomes a piece that the UAE living room swallows. Furniture height, depth and overall footprint all need to be adjusted upward to match UAE room scales.

The Majlis Is a Specific Design Problem

The UAE majlis — a formal reception room with perimeter seating and a central coffee table arrangement — does not work with standard living room furniture logic. The seating must be at the correct height for extended seated conversation (slightly lower than a standard Western sofa), arranged in a perimeter configuration that allows eye contact across the room, and scaled to fill the perimeter without creating a central void that feels empty. Lead Times Are Long

Premium furniture delivery to the UAE from European and Asian manufacturers typically takes 8–16 weeks. This means furniture decisions must be made earlier in the renovation timeline than most clients expect — and changes after ordering are expensive or impossible. Fabric Durability in UAE Conditions

UAE AC systems circulate air continuously, which accelerates dust accumulation in certain fabric types. High-traffic family homes with children benefit from performance fabrics — solution-dyed or coated weaves that resist staining and clean easily without degrading. Velvet and natural linen upholstery are beautiful but require more maintenance in UAE family homes than their showroom appearance suggests. NESMAT matches fabric specification to the client’s realistic cleaning commitment and household use pattern.

Outdoor Furniture Material in UAE Climate

Standard outdoor furniture sold in UAE retail is often specified for Mediterranean or Northern European conditions, not Gulf heat and UV. Teak weathers well but requires annual oiling. Powder-coated aluminium is the most practical frame material for UAE outdoor use. Rope and synthetic weave furniture degrades faster in sustained direct sun than in shaded outdoor environments. Cushion fabrics must be solution-dyed acrylic — standard outdoor fabrics fade visibly within one UAE summer in direct sun. Furniture Arrival Sequence in Renovations

In UAE renovation projects, furniture should arrive after flooring installation is complete but before final painting touch-ups — so any delivery scuffs on newly painted walls can be corrected. Heavy furniture placed on new marble or porcelain floors requires proper felt pads and careful placement to avoid scratch marks on the surface. Honest Cost Guide — Furniture Supply UAE

What Determines Furniture Supply Cost in the UAE?

Furniture cost in the UAE is one of the most variable of all interior expenditure categories — ranging from affordable to extremely premium for pieces that are superficially similar in photographs. Understanding what drives meaningful quality differences helps UAE clients invest their furniture budget where it produces the most lasting impact.

The most significant cost driver in furniture quality is construction — not visible from a photograph. A sofa’s internal frame material (solid hardwood versus engineered wood versus MDF), the suspension system (eight-way hand-tied springs versus zigzag springs versus foam-only), the foam density and the fabric construction all determine whether the piece looks the same after five years of UAE family use as it did on delivery day. Premium furniture from reputable manufacturers costs more at the point of purchase and holds its form, comfort and appearance significantly longer than budget alternatives that look similar in a showroom.

The second significant cost driver is size — UAE room scales require larger pieces, and larger pieces cost proportionally more. A sofa at 300 cm costs approximately 30–40% more than the same design at 220 cm, and in a UAE villa living room the larger piece is usually the correct one. What sofa size should I choose for a UAE villa living room?

For a UAE villa living room, the minimum sofa size for a room of 5 metres or wider is typically a 3-seater at 280–300 cm, or an L-shape configuration from 300 cm. Standard European 3-seater sofas at 220 cm look visually undersized in UAE villa proportions — the room swallows the furniture rather than the furniture defining the room. The correct approach is to map the furniture footprint on the floor plan first, confirming clearances to the coffee table (45–60 cm recommended), movement paths (90 cm minimum) and wall distances — then select the piece size that works within those constraints. How long does furniture delivery take in the UAE?

In-stock furniture from UAE showrooms and local retailers typically delivers in one to three weeks. Made-to-order or imported premium furniture from European and Asian manufacturers typically takes 8–16 weeks depending on the manufacturer, customisation level and shipping route. Custom upholstered pieces with selected fabric often sit at the 10–14 week range. What fabric should I choose for a sofa in a UAE family home?

For UAE family homes with children or regular heavy use, the most practical upholstery choices are performance fabrics — solution-dyed or coated weaves with stain-resistance properties that allow cleaning without degrading the fabric surface. Crypton, Revolution, and various proprietary performance fabric ranges from major manufacturers are designed specifically for this use case. Velvet is a high-maintenance choice in UAE family settings — it marks easily, requires specific cleaning and accumulates dust from AC airflow.
